About Katharina Nöbauer

Katharina Nöbauer is a scholar working on Animal Science and Zoology, Parasitology and Virology, having authored 34 papers that have together received 691 indexed citations. Recurring topics across this work include Meat and Animal Product Quality (4 papers), Advanced Proteomics Techniques and Applications (4 papers) and Coccidia and coccidiosis research (3 papers). The work is most often cited by research in Animal Science and Zoology (83 citations), Parasitology (48 citations) and Microbiology (43 citations). Katharina Nöbauer has collaborated with scholars based in Austria, Germany and Spain. Frequent co-authors include Ebrahim Razzazi‐Fazeli, Karin Anna Hummel, Michael Heß, Ingrid Miller, Claudia Hess, Merima Alispahic, Miriam Klausberger, Petra Kramberger, Alois Jungbauer and Reingard Grabherr. Their work appears in journals such as PLoS ONE, Scientific Reports and International Journal of Molecular Sciences.
